It is a long and marvelous hike in, through dense dark forests, with giant ferns and mosses and mushrooms, and steeply upwards to where a huge slab of mountainside slid away, exposing tons of the underlying rock. The formation was deposited during the Eocene, some 45-55 million years ago. And it is absolutely filled with fossils.
The remains of palm leaves tell tale of a much warmer world.
Most of these are absolutely enormous (not to mention rare), and I leave them for future admirers. However, some of the smaller rocks can be sheared apart, and make for good collectables. The fossils are so abundant that almost any new cleavage plane will be covered in them:
My collection now is a few dozen samples strong, covering 11 unique intervals of Earth history. The first couple hundred million years are fairly easy to find here, and it's possible to go back almost 2 billion if one looks hard enough. Beyond that, things will prove difficult. This will probably be a project I continue for many years to come.
And of course, there are no rocks known to exist of the Hadean (or at least the oldest I am aware of is 4.03 Gya, according to wikipedia). The only things older are a few tiny resilient zircon crystals. Or, if you look to material which is not of this world...

I'm no stacking expert at all, but I'd suggest the "DeepSkyStacker" software, there is plenty tutorials around to help you. You also would need calibration frames, some are pretty easy to take, others need a bit more set up. Depending on your computer power and number of frames to stack, reducing or cropping the original images may be a good idea.

Antza2, another very good tutorial for 'the theory' of image calibration and processing can be found here (also linked through the DeepSkyStacker FAQ). I like this one as it keeps the explanation fairly simple, showing why we do each of these steps as well as examples of the effect they have on the image with different numbers of frames.
It seems like a daunting procedure at first, but it's actually pretty easy once you get the hang of it. And not all of the steps are required -- even just stacking the light frames will improve the signal to noise. But the more of the calibration you do and especially the more frames you take, the bigger the improvement will be. I think it's definitely worth trying out.
